Job summary
An exciting opportunity has arisen for an enthusiastic Salaried GP to join our friendly, supportive and forward-thinking practice in the heart of Cornwall.
Based in Truro, Cornwall's cathedral city, Lander Medical Practice is committed to delivering high-quality, patient-centred care while maintaining a strong focus on clinician wellbeing and work-life balance. We are looking for a GP to join our team of 8 partners and 4 salaried GPs, working a negotiable number of sessions, ideally 6 per week.
This role offers the opportunity to work in a highly regarded training practice, within a thriving Primary Care Network, supported by an experienced multidisciplinary team.
Main duties of the job
The successful candidate will provide high-quality general medical services to our practice population, delivering safe, effective and compassionate care.
Key responsibilities will include:
- Undertaking routine GP consultations and clinical assessments.
- Managing acute and chronic conditions in line with best practice.
- Participating in practice meetings, clinical discussions and service development activities.
- Supporting education and training within the practice where appropriate.
- Working collaboratively with the wider multidisciplinary team, including pharmacists, physiotherapists, paramedics, community services and Integrated Neighbourhood Teams.
Opportunities are available to develop special interests, teaching and research activities.
About us
Lander Medical Practice serves a population of over 20,000 patients and is recognised as one of Cornwall's highest-performing practices, with excellent quality outcomes. We share modern premises with Three Spires Medical Practice, and together form a highly successful Primary Care Network.
We benefit from a well-established multidisciplinary workforce, including paramedics, pharmacists, physiotherapists, GP assistants and workflow administrators, helping to reduce administrative burden and support excellent patient care.
As a long-standing GP training practice and partner of the University of Exeter Medical School, we are committed to education, professional development and innovation. We offer regular clinical meetings, protected learning time and practice development days, alongside a supportive team culture that values collaboration, continuity of care and clinician wellbeing.
Located within easy reach of Cornwall's coastline and countryside, Truro offers an outstanding quality of life alongside excellent transport links and a vibrant cultural community.
